Occupations with the Most Annual Job Openings

Occupations projected to have the most average annual job openings (from growth plus replacement needs), per BLS Employment Projections.

The top-ranked entry is Fast Food and Counter Workers at 904,300 (+6.1% growth). The full top 100 is listed below.
